Does the Demon 170 come with drag tires?
The 151-mph trap speed, effectively, is the Dodge Challenger SRT Demon 170 top speed: the Mickey Thompson drag radial tires – which come standard and each measure over a foot wide in the rear – shouldn’t really be pushed any further. How big are Demon 170 tires?
Working closely with Dodge engineers, Mickey T developed versions of its ET Street R and ET Street Front tires just for the Demon 170. They have a staggered fitment (P315/50R17 rear, 245/55R18 front) designed to transfer power to the rear tires, lower rolling resistance, and improve handling. The Demon 170 is primarily designed to run on high-octane gasoline and handle fuel blends. For the Dodge Demon 170, E10 (pump fuel with 90% gasoline and 10% ethanol) produces 900 horsepower and 810 lb-ft of torque, whereas 85% ethanol race fuel produces 1,025 horsepower and 945 lb-ft.
